currently the ImageJ macro language does not support ovals with subpixel resolution, neither for drawing nor as overlays.
I would suggest using short lines perpendicular to the long line, i.e., small tick marks. You can have these in the ROI Manager (show all) or as overlayer, both with subpixel resolution.
By the way, please make sure that you update ImageJ to the last version; the shift between the lines and ovals reminds me of a problem prior to version 1.48e.

> you can use an overlay instead of drawing. The overlay can have a line thickness of "zero", which means as thin as possible at any magnification.
>
> Image>Overlay>Add Selection. Hold the alt key to set the properties of the overlay.
>
>
> Another (similar) approach is saving the lines to the ROI Manager instead of drawing them, and using 'show all' in the Roi Manager.
>
>
> To save the image with an overlay or rois, save it as tiff or zip.
